Trojan.Dooxud.A

Posted: May 17, 2011

Trojan.Dooxud.A is a mischievous computer trojan that penetrates the computer system secretly without the targeted user's consent. Trojan.Dooxud.A cannot propagate on its own right, and it needs to be delivered through a variety of means. Trojan.Dooxud.A enables remote access to the corrupted computer via the Internet; it depends on the attacker responsible for this infection, what the Trojan.Dooxud.A will do to the infected computer. Trojan.Dooxud.A comes with a particular payload in that it locks the Internet Explorer's toolbar. Trojan.Dooxud.A then contacts a remote host over the network for various intentions which involve reports about a new infection to the makers of the malware, receiving of program configurations, receiving of instructions from a remote attacker and uploads of the data stolen from the affected computer.
